- [ ] **Step 7: Breaker override escrow.** After sealing the signing keys for the Tallgrove upstream API circuit breaker, confirm the support team can force the breaker open during a full outage. The override bundle lives in the sealed escrow drawer and is useless without its unlock phrase. Two ceremony witnesses must initial this step before proceeding. The escrow bundle is decrypted with the recovery passphrase that follows.

vault phrase of kahip-kahop = holath-quenmir

## Formula sandbox tuning

User-supplied formulas in Gridmoor execute inside a restricted interpreter with hard ceilings on time, memory, and call depth. Reviewers should confirm any change to these ceilings is justified in the PR description, since raising them widens the abuse surface. Defaults were chosen from production traces. The current limits are as follows.

limits module of tafog-fawip:
WEIGHTS = {
    "julix": 57,
    "lamys": 992,
    "kasvan": 209,
    "quenok": 750,
    "alddor": 259,
    "oliath": 1009,
    "wenix": 815,
}

The garage occupancy feed for the Brindlewood campus arrives over a message queue every thirty seconds, one record per level, published by the Stallgrid edge boxes. Counts can briefly go negative when a sensor double-fires on exit; the ingest job clamps these to zero and flags the interval. If the feed stalls for more than five minutes, the dashboard falls back to the last known snapshot. Sensor mappings, queue names, and the replay procedure are documented on the internal page below.

runbook for tahog-kadug: https://gitlab.qirvanworks.corp/projects/pages/view/b139298aed28

Handover — Vexler partner SFTP drop

Ownership moves to you today. Drop runs hourly from Vexler's end into the intake bucket via the relay host. Watch for zero-byte files; their exporter flakes on Mondays. Creds live in the ops vault, path noted in the runbook. Vault auto-seals after 48h idle. Support escalations go to the on-call rotation, not me. If the vault is sealed when you need it, unseal with the recovery passphrase below.

recovery phrase for tadug-fafof: zorwyn-kasion